Xanthan Gum

While xanthan gum-based thickening powders offer many proven advantages over starch-based powders, shortcomings remain in some xanthan-based agents currently marketed for use with dysphagia patients.

Many dysphagia patients require multiple medications and supplements for better nutrition and health. Many medications and nutritionally-necessary minerals are positively charged. Xanthan powder naturally carries a negative charge, causing it to bind to positively charged materials.

While all thickening agents bind to some degree, xanthan is a soluble fiber and passes through the body undigested. Any material that binds to the xanthan in the digestion process may be excreted without being absorbed into the bloodstream. For patients who take medications orally with a xanthan-thickened beverage or who must thicken nutritional supplements such as Ensure or Boost, some or all of the medication and nutrients may not be bioavailable to the patient.

Several studies have shown lower-than-expected blood serum concentrations of nutrients and medications when administered with xanthan-thickened beverages.

Solution to the problem

My team has researched a solution for this serious problem by developing a proprietary xanthan powder formulation that supports the absorption of nutrients.

Click here for more information about the Clear Advantage formula from Thick-It!

By using ascorbic acid (vitamin C) to acidify the xanthan, Thick-It Clear Advantage reduces the likelihood that positively-charged medications and nutrients will bind to it. Medications and nutrients can dissolve and be absorbed by patients more easily than with other xanthan-based thickening powders.

These results were verified by extensive research. First, in vitro studies proved the hypothesis that ascorbic acid inhibits the bonding of xanthan powder with positive ions. Then, in vivo studies were performed at the University of Wisconsin–Stout.

The experiment

To test the hypothesis via blind trials, piglets were fed xanthan-thickened breast milk or formula. Researchers tested the blood to determine the levels of nutrients absorbed. Compared to plain xanthan, the acidified Clear Advantage formula delivered the most favorable results of several agents being studied, specifically when measuring levels of iron, calcium, and zinc. This pioneering research earned patents for both its process and formula.

Conclusion

Clearly, bioavailability of medications and nutritional supplements is a critical concern in providing nutrition and treatment for patients with dysphagia. This modified xanthan-based thickener can be used with medications and nutritional supplements to increase the absorption of active ingredients.

(Note: All medications may not have the same absorption results.)

GLOSSARY OF TERMS

IN VITRO

Outside the body. Made to occur in a laboratory vessel or other controlled experimental environment, rather than within a living organism.

IN VIVO

Inside the body. Made to occur within the living. Studies that are tested on whole, living organisms.

XANTHAN GUM

A polysaccharide secreted by the bacterium Xanthamonas campesteris, used as a food additive and rheology modifier. It is composed of pentasaccharide repeating units comprising glucose, mannose and glucuronic acid.

INDICATIONS AND USAGE:

VARIBAR ® THIN HONEY (barium sulfate) oral suspension, VARIBAR ® NECTAR (barium sulfate) oral suspension, and VARIBAR ® THIN LIQUID (barium sulfate) for oral suspension, are indicated for use in modified barium swallow examinations to evaluate the oral and pharyngeal function and morphology in adult and pediatric patients. VARIBAR ® HONEY (barium sulfate) oral suspension and VARIBAR ® PUDDING (barium sulfate) oral paste are indicated for use in modified barium swallow examinations to evaluate the oral and pharyngeal function and morphology in adult and pediatric patients 6 months of age and older.

IMPORTANT SAFETY INFORMATION:
For Oral Administration. This product should not be used in patients with known or suspected perforation of the GI tract, known obstruction of the GI tract, high risk of aspiration, or hypersensitivity to barium sulfate products. Rarely, severe allergic reactions of anaphylactoid nature have been reported following administration of barium sulfate contrast agents. Aspiration may occur during the modified barium swallow examination, monitor the patient for aspiration.
